How The Future of Law Enforcement: Can Sheriff Mark Dannels Deliver on His Promises? Actually Works

At its core, The Future of Law Enforcement: Can Sheriff Mark Dannels Deliver on His Promises? is about the practical implementation of policy. A sheriff’s office typically focuses on patrol operations, jail management, court security, and serving legal documents. For example, a promise to reduce response times might involve optimizing patrol routes using real-time crime data or adding deputies to high-incident zones. Imagine a scenario where community feedback highlights a surge in residential burglaries; a proactive approach could include targeted nighttime patrols and neighborhood watch partnerships. The measurement of success often relies on crime statistics, citizen satisfaction surveys, and budget adherence. Ultimately, delivery hinges on aligning stated goals with measurable actions and transparent reporting to the public they serve.


H3: What specific reforms are being discussed around The Future of Law Enforcement: Can Sheriff Mark Dannels Deliver on His Promises?

Many discussions focus on modernization efforts such as adopting new technologies for body cameras, digital evidence management, and mobile reporting apps. There is also talk about enhanced training for de-escalation tactics and mental health crisis intervention. These reforms aim to build public confidence while improving officer safety. For instance, implementing a robust early warning system could help identify patterns in officer behavior before minor issues escalate. Communities often wonder how these changes will be funded, leading to debates about grant utilization and budget priorities. The conversation remains grounded in balancing innovation with the foundational mission of community protection.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A common myth is that The Future of Law Enforcement: Can Sheriff Mark Dannels Deliver on His Promises? implies a radical shift in policing methods overnight. In reality, meaningful reform typically occurs in phases, requiring time for training, technology integration, and policy review. Another misunderstanding is that increased visibility, such as more patrol cars, automatically equals reduced crime, when data often shows that community trust and socioeconomic factors play larger roles. It is also incorrectly assumed that all promises are political slogans without accountability mechanisms. Clear performance indicators and regular public updates are essential for tracking progress. Correcting these misconceptions helps create a more informed dialogue about public safety.
